Output e03d44e9e242ea3c5c21102be5d8c5f37bceb7ea50eb9efe5f9f635ad92979c3:4

value
129652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e08bb5672b75bcc4d9b1632a381d5498ee57ba0 OP_EQUAL
address
35tRU4ctQWWkbBaeo3tLVCGzyLsXqfkSu7
transaction
e03d44e9e242ea3c5c21102be5d8c5f37bceb7ea50eb9efe5f9f635ad92979c3